Output 7a858a3965df53bfbe161a61c2326034c79f64515e9e77463a6f99a445788c7b:0

value
22162101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 094364cabbac1f721282f960eac88b68ff3d9494 OP_EQUAL
address
32XzjsHo27xbkmCGDPydaoZjQ14EpZr2ZG
transaction
7a858a3965df53bfbe161a61c2326034c79f64515e9e77463a6f99a445788c7b
spent
true